G. I. Brides Leaving Paris By Train (1940 1949)
Paris, France. Various shots of the French brides of American soldiers, some with babies in arms, leaving Paris. Many are accompanied by their husbands. They are seen on the train platform, entering train, leaning out of carriages and waving, platform crowded with people, some of the girls are interviewed by press. Their weeping parents wave them goodbye. Train leaving the station, people waving, brides waving back from train. Military band playing on platform. Press taking photographs of the families.
